Easy Dump-and-Bake Fried Rice

One-pan baked fried rice with vegetables, protein, and eggs, flavored with soy sauce and sesame oil for an easy weeknight meal.

Ingredients
  

Rice Mixture
  • 4 cups cooked rice preferably chilled
  • 2 cups mixed vegetables peas, carrots, corn, bell pepper
  • 2 cups cooked protein chicken, shrimp, or tofu, diced
  • 3 eggs lightly beaten
  • 0.25 cup soy sauce
  • 2 tbsp sesame oil
  • 2 cloves garlic minced
  • 1 tsp grated ginger
  • 3 green onions sliced
  • salt and black pepper to taste
  • sesame seeds optional garnish

Method
 

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C) and grease baking dish.
  2. Combine rice, vegetables, and protein in a large bowl.
  3. Stir in garlic, ginger, soy sauce, sesame oil, salt, and pepper.
  4. Pour mixture into baking dish, make a small well, add eggs, fold gently.
  5. Cover with foil and bake 20 minutes, then remove foil and bake 10 more minutes.
  6. Remove, stir gently, garnish with green onions and sesame seeds.

Notes

Use chilled rice for best texture; adjust seasoning to taste.
